Analysis
In 2024, import unit value index in Lithuania stood at 142.8 2015 = 100.
That represents a change of down 0.9% on the previous year and up 12.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, import unit value index in Lithuania peaked at 156 2015 = 100 in 2022 and was at its lowest, 54.6 2015 = 100, in 2001.
Lithuania ranks 37th of 207 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.

About this data
Import unit value indices come from UNCTAD's trade database. Unit value indices are based on data reported by countries that demonstrate consistency under UNCTAD quality controls, supplemented by UNCTAD’s estimates using the previous year’s trade values at the Standard International Trade Classification three-digit level as weights. To improve data coverage, especially for the latest periods, UNCTAD constructs a set of average prices indexes at the three-digit product classification of the Standard International Trade Classification revision 3 using UNCTAD’s Commodity Price Statistics, international and national sources, and UNCTAD secretariat estimates. This indicator is an index series where 2015=100.
